A common question people like to ask is, what are domain investors putting their money into these days? Well, the guys most of us read about are always buying and selling top-notch one word domains like Planets.com. Obviously, these types of domains rarely drop and even when they do, the odds of getting one for less than 4 or 5 figures is pretty much out of the question. That being said, people are always curious about what other types of domain names they CAN actually drop catch and store away for investment purposes. Believe it or not, there are some great opportunities out there and they don’t even involve the .COM extension!

Before you continue reading this you should be familiar with some of the common domain acronyms like ‘CVCV’ or ‘NNNN.’ If you’re not, have a quick look at this post and catch up on the common domain acronyms!

A year or two ago you could easily register almost any dropping NNNN.net for the cost of registration fee. Since then, the market for them has completely blown up! Four number domains always receive backorders and catching them for registration fee is practically impossible. This type of activity could signal future demand for LLLL.net domains as well. Once the four number domains are taken the four letter domains could very well be next to go. Important Note, that does NOT mean you go out and register every single available four leter .NET that you see! Instead, at this point in time you should only focus on four letter domains which have the least number of possible combinations, such as VCVC or CVCV. Since there are only a limited number of possible CVCV.net and VCVC.net combinations these types of domains will hold a higher value, especially once all LLLL.net domains have been registered! Along with that, you should only focus on the domains which contain at least three (if not, all four) premium letters. This gives your domain EVEN MORE value when all LLLL.net domains are taken. Why? Because there are even LESS possible four letter CVCV and VCVC.net combinations which contain three or four premium letters in them.

When you filter through the lists of dropping .NET domains you may see that there are about 200 LLLL.NET domains deleting in one day. However, out of those 200 only a few will have a possible VCVC or CVCV combination. Out of those few, you may be lucky if one or two contain all four premium letters. That alone tells me that people are either developing these types of domains, or they are holding on to them and not letting them drop!

Right now is the time to pickup those premium CVCV and VCVC.net domains. Once the demand kicks in and the numbers get slim you won’t be buying them for registration fee anymore! Have a look at some recent NNNN.net domain sales:

After some quick searching I found that there are only a few CVCV.net domains dropping over the next few days. Since the CVCV combination seams to be more popular and holds a slightly higher resale value than VCVC I would recommend sticking with those for now. Here are some that drop over the next few days.

If you already own a copy of DesktopCatcher you should consider searching and chasing these types of domains to add into your portfolio. Keep in mind, they don’t hold a huge value right now and that’s exactly why they’re an investment. Buy now while you can and be prepared to sit on them for two or three years. Remember, focus on CVCV combinations, premium and/or repeating letters (such as Xaja above has repeating A’s), and be prepared to park them. Once the market picks up you can make nice returns on a small portfolio of CVCV.net domains!
